+/* plht.c - shared halftone resource. */
+#include "stdpre.h"
+#include "gstypes.h"
+#include "gsmemory.h"
+#include "gxtmap.h"
+/* Define an abstract type for the PostScript graphics state. */
+#ifndef gs_state_DEFINED
+# define gs_state_DEFINED
+typedef struct gs_state_s gs_state;
+#endif
+#include "gsstate.h"
+#include "gxht.h"
+#include "gxdevice.h"
+#include "plht.h"
+
+int
+pl_set_pcl_halftone(gs_state *pgs, gs_mapping_proc transfer_proc,
+ int width, int height,
+ gs_string threshold_data,
+ int phase_x,
+ int phase_y)
+{
+
+ int code;
+ gs_halftone ht;
+ /* nothing to do for a contone device */
+ if ( !gx_device_must_halftone(gs_currentdevice(pgs)) )
+ return 0;
+ gs_settransfer(pgs, transfer_proc);
+ ht.type = ht_type_threshold;
+ ht.params.threshold.width = width;
+ ht.params.threshold.height = height;
+ ht.params.threshold.thresholds.data = threshold_data.data;
+ ht.params.threshold.thresholds.size = threshold_data.size;
+ ht.params.threshold.transfer = 0;
+ ht.params.threshold.transfer_closure.proc = 0;
+ code = gs_sethalftone(pgs, &ht);
+ if ( code < 0 )
+ return code;
+ return gs_sethalftonephase(pgs, phase_x, phase_y);
+}
